2025 Fantasy Outlook
Samuelson struggled to find a consistent role early in her career, but she's appeared in 63 games across the last two seasons while putting together solid production for the Sparks and Mystics. Over 29 appearances (19 starts) for Washington last year, she averaged 8.4 points, 2.6 rebounds and 2.1 assists in 24.6 minutes per game, which made her a fairly consistent fantasy option. However, Samuelson lost out on her starting job over the final few months of the season, and she was traded to the Lynx in mid-April. It's unlikely that she'll be able to carve out as much playing time with her new team, and she'll likely have to settle for a bench role behind Napheesa Collier and Bridget Carleton. Samuelson's production over the last two seasons made her an intriguing late-round fantasy option, but she profiles more as a streaming candidate ahead of the 2025 campaign. Read Past Outlooks

Parting ways with Dallas
The Wings are expected to waive Samuelson (foot), Melissa Triebwasser of Winsidr.com reports.
ANALYSIS
Samuelson was included in the trade that sent Diamond Miller to the Wings on Sunday, but the former is now set to head into free agency. The 30-year-old Samuelson is on the mend from season-ending left foot surgery, which she underwent in July. Samuelson should be back to full health ahead of the 2026 season.

2024 Fantasy Outlook
Samuelson didn't make more than 20 appearances in a season across her first four years in the league, but she had a career-best season in 2023 since the Sparks were dealing with several absences. Samuelson made 34 appearances (23 starts) and averaged 7.7 points, 3.0 rebounds and 2.0 assists in 26.1 minutes per game. She shot 42.6 percent from beyond the arc on 3.4 attempts per game, which ranked third in the league among players who had at least 3.0 attempts per game. She's proven to have the talent to be a fantasy-relevant option, and she signed with the Mystics over the offseason -- a team in need of perimeter shooting. That could bode well for her fantasy upside.
